Specimen of notes on the statute law of Scotland, from the first parliament of James I to the accession of James VI, by David Dalrymple, Lord Hailes.
File
Identifier: MS.990
Scope and Contents
Contains three of the printed, interleaved copies which Lord Hailes issued privately and sent to legal authorities for their remarks, with autograph notes by Lord Auchinleck, James Gordon, Advocate, and Hailes himself.

Arrangement
ii + 38 + 38 + ii + 38 pages + v + 62 folios. The papers were received bound.
Custodial History
The papers were bought by the National Library of Scotland with the aid of the Reid Fund.
Immediate Source of Acquisition
Bought, 1934.
Bibliography
See 'A brief memoir of the life and writings of Sir David Dalrymple' (Edinburgh, 1833, number 16.
